Thanks, the compliments inspire me to keep at it. I don't have a diet completely set and I don't plan to yet. I just make sure I eat something healthy every 2-3 hours. I've also been making sure to eat enough calories of foods other than junk food or processed foods. I've been doing the eliptical or stationary bike for about 30-40 minutes 3 days a week, and lifting on alternate days, rest on Sundays. I've also been going to open gym and play some basketball here and there. I hope that helps!
